St. Mary Parish prosecutors will seek the death penalty against a Charenton man indicted for killing a neighbor and a Chitimacha Tribal Police officer.

Yesterday 48-year-old Wilbert Thibodeaux changed his plea to not guilty by reason of insanity in the deaths of neighbor 78-year-old Eddie Lyons and Sgt. Rick Riggenbach in January of this year.

Thibodeaux was indicted on March 19 on two counts of first-degree murder and initially pleaded not guilty.

Thibodeaux was also charged with wounding two St. Mary Parish Sheriff's Office deputies and also setting Lyons' mobile home on fire.

District Judge Keith Comeaux gave the public defender's office until Oct. 1 to file a motion for a sanity hearing.
